WebDec 15, 2024 · Alexandrites change colors because of a unique and rare chemical composition. They are actually chrysoberyl. Chrysoberyl contains iron and titanium. Alexandrite contains chromium, and it is this element that contributes to the startling color changes. It is only chrysoberyl displaying distinct color changes that is called alexandrite. WebAug 3, 2016 · Zultanite is the trade name of diaspore that exhibits a color-change effect; the material appears yellow, pink, or green in different light sources. Zultanite has only been found in the Anatolian Mountains of Turkey (M. Hatipoglu and M. Akgun, “Zultanite, or colour-change diaspore from the Milas (Mugla) region, Turkey,” Australian ... WebGrandidierite has a hardness of 7.5, which makes it very resistant to scratching and ideal for jewelry use. However, it also has perfect and good cleavage in two directions, which makes it challenging to cut. Of course, its scarcity has also made this a relatively little-known gemstone.
